1. What is Absolute Lymphocyte Count (ALC)?

The Absolute Lymphocyte Count (ALC) is a measure of the total number of lymphocytes in the blood, calculated by multiplying the total white blood cell count by the percentage of lymphocytes. It provides more clinically useful information than the percentage alone.

2. How Does the Calculator Work?

The calculator uses the ALC formula:

\[ ALC = WBC\ Count \times \frac{Lymphocyte\ \%}{100} \]

Explanation: The formula converts the relative lymphocyte percentage into an absolute count, which is more meaningful for clinical interpretation.

3. Importance of ALC Calculation

Details: ALC is important for evaluating immune status, diagnosing lymphopenia or lymphocytosis, monitoring chemotherapy patients, and assessing viral infections or immune disorders.

5.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1: What is a normal ALC range?
A: Normal range is typically 1,000-4,800 cells/μL in adults, though ranges vary by age and laboratory.

Q2: When is ALC considered low (lymphopenia)?
A: Generally <1,000 cells/μL in adults, or <1,500 cells/μL in children. Critical if <500 cells/μL.

Q3: What causes high ALC (lymphocytosis)?
A: Viral infections, certain bacterial infections, leukemia, lymphoma, and autoimmune disorders.

Q4: How often should ALC be monitored?
A: Frequency depends on clinical context - daily for hospitalized patients, weekly for chemotherapy, or as needed for outpatient monitoring.

Q5: Are there limitations to ALC interpretation?
A: Yes, always interpret in clinical context. Some automated counters may misclassify atypical lymphocytes.
